Security First: Handling Broken Glass
Before beginning any repair project, it's vital to prioritize security. Broken glass can trigger cuts, injuries, and further damage if managed improperly. Here's a list of security products to think about:
- Protective gloves: Use durable gloves to prevent cuts.
- Safety goggles: Shield your eyes from glass shards.
- Dust mask: Protect yourself from breathing in great glass particles.
- Thick towels or blankets: To securely gather and transfer broken glass pieces.

Repair Techniques for Common Types of Glass
1. Repairing Windows
Fractures and Chips
- Materials Needed: Glass adhesive or epoxy.
- Approach:
- Clean the area around the crack with glass cleaner to eliminate dirt and grime.
- Use the glass adhesive straight into the crack utilizing a small applicator tool.
- Press the edges gently together and use clamps to hold them in location till treated.
Shattered Windows
- Products Needed: Replacement glass or Plexiglas, glazing putty, and an utility knife.
- Approach:
- Remove shattered glass thoroughly, guaranteeing safety throughout the procedure.
- Step the opening and cut the replacement glass to size.
- Insert the new glass and secure it with glazing putty, smoothing it with a putty knife.
2. Repairing Mirrors
Cracks and Chips
- Materials Needed: Backing repair adhesive.
- Method:
- Gently tidy the broken area with a soft cloth and glass cleaner.
- Use the adhesive to a thin support board and place it firmly over the crack.
- Let it treat totally before attempting to hang or move the mirror.
3. Repairing Tabletops
Chips and Cracks
- Products Needed: Epoxy filler and glass adhesive.
- Method:
- Clean the chipped location completely.
- Use epoxy filler to complete the chip, smoothing it with a putty knife.
- For fractures, apply glass adhesive along the crack line and let it dry.

Frequently Asked Questions about Broken Glass Repair
1. Can I repair broken glass myself or should I employ a professional?
Numerous small repairs can be dealt with by DIY lovers, especially if they have the right tools and products. Nevertheless, significant damages or those involving security or structural stability must be evaluated by professionals.
2. For how long does it consider glass adhesive to treat?
Curing time can differ based upon the adhesive used. Normally, it can take anywhere from one hour to 24 hours. Constantly check the item guidelines for the specific treating time.
3. What if the fracture is too wish for a simple repair?
If a fracture is substantial, changing the whole glass panel might be your best choice, as any efforts to repair it could jeopardize integrity and security.
